Ingredients
- 6 hard-cooked eggs, peeled
- 1/4 cup of mayonnaise
- 1/2 teaspoon McCormick Mustard, Ground
- 1/2 teaspoon McCormick Parsley Flakes
- 1/4 teaspoon season salt
- McCormick Paprika
Directions
- Slice eggs in half lengthwise. Remove yolks; place in small bowl. Mash yolks with fork or potato masher.
- Stir in mayonnaise, mustard, parsley and seasoned salt until smooth and creamy. Spoon or pipe yolk mixture into egg white halves. Sprinkle with paprika.
- Refrigerate 1 hour or until ready to serve.
